From 3b3bd067d0ff2671fca2890c14428c97e1011a2b Mon Sep 17 00:00:00 2001
From: Jake Vanderwerf <get@jakevanderwerf.ca>
Date: Wed, 11 Feb 2026 03:20:21 +0000
Subject: [PATCH] =Hey guess what? Meta->set() and Meta->setAll() doesn't actually save the meta to the database. Went through the files and added a ->save() call after every set

---
 inc/rest/routes/ShopRoutes.php |    7 +++++--
 1 files changed, 5 insertions(+), 2 deletions(-)

diff --git a/inc/rest/routes/ShopRoutes.php b/inc/rest/routes/ShopRoutes.php
index 4f69614..83132a0 100644
--- a/inc/rest/routes/ShopRoutes.php
+++ b/inc/rest/routes/ShopRoutes.php
@@ -173,7 +173,8 @@
             }
 		}
 
-		$results = $meta->setAll($setData);
+		$meta->setAll($setData);
+		$results = $meta->save();
 
 //        $results = [];
 //
@@ -1383,8 +1384,10 @@
 
 
         $userMeta->set($uMeta, $shops);
+		$userMeta->save();
 
         $artistMeta->set($aMeta, $shops);
+		$artistMeta->save();
 
         $owners = $shopMeta->get($sMeta);
         $owners = ($owners === '') ? [] : explode(',', $shops);
@@ -1393,7 +1396,7 @@
         }
         $owners = implode(',', $owners);
         $shopMeta->set($sMeta, $owners);
-
+		$shopMeta->save();
         return true;
     }
 }

--
Gitblit v1.10.0